Challenge Problems

Push your limits with challenges.

Question 1

You are given a linear programming problem with the constraints 2x + 3y <= 12 and x + y <= 5. Graph these constraints, find the feasible region, and determine the optimal solution if Z = 5x + 4y.

πŸ’‘ Hint: Remember to check each constraint at the points you evaluate.

Question 2

A farmer wants to maximize the production of two crops, corn and wheat, with available land represented by the constraints X + 2Y ≀ 20 and 3X + Y ≀ 30. Determine the optimal crop mix using the graphical method.

πŸ’‘ Hint: Maximize the objective function at the vertices of the feasible region you've plotted.
